🏠 Buyer Tips

Get pre-approved before touring fixer uppers to strengthen offers. Hire a qualified home inspector to identify structural issues and renovation costs. Budget 15-20% above estimates for unexpected repairs. Research comparable sales of renovated homes to ensure profitable investments. Work with agents experienced in investment properties who understand Covina's neighborhoods and market conditions thoroughly.

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es Covina a good market for fixer uppers? +
Covina offers affordable entry prices, strong rental demand, and appreciation potential. The San Gabriel Valley sees steady growth with revitalization initiatives. Investors find better value than West Los Angeles while maintaining proximity to job centers and urban amenities.
How much should I budget for renovations on a Covina fixer upper? +
Budget $100-200 per square foot for cosmetic updates, $200-400 for moderate renovations including systems. Major structural work costs significantly more. Get multiple contractor estimates and add 15-20% contingency for unexpected issues commonly found in older homes.
Are fixer uppers in Covina good investment properties? +
Yes, Covina's fixer uppers attract investors seeking rental income and appreciation. Strong tenant demand, reasonable purchase prices, and potential 20-30% appreciation make strategic purchases profitable. Analyze individual properties carefully and understand neighborhood trends before investing.

How long does it take to renovate and sell a fixer upper in Covina? +
Cosmetic updates take 2-4 months, moderate renovations 3-6 months, major structural work 6-12+ months. Marketing adds 1-3 months. Total timelines range 6-18 months depending on scope. Professional project management helps maintain budgets and schedules for successful completion.
